Optimal Design Of Working Mechanism Of Wheel Loaders

Wheel loader is a kind of earthmoving machinery,it can be used to load,lift and dump material through bucket and a linkage mechanism(which named working device)installed at the front end of machine.Based on a Z-bar linkage wheel loader(L120),this article studies and analyzes the optimal design and verification method of the working device linkage mechanism,ensured the target life requirements of working device and shortened the product development time.This article first introduces the design method of the wheel loader working device.By analyzing the actual working conditions of wheel loader,the typical working conditions of loaders are determined.And simplify the calculation model of the whole machine and combine with "the load calculation program" of a loader to calculate the bearing load,breakout force and lift force of the working device.Secondly,based on the analysis of typical working conditions of the loader,the working conditions with heavy load and complicated force are selected for static load strength analysis,which avoids the damage of the linkage mechanism caused by the possible ultimate load;further improve the linkage mechanism design.Finally,explores a new fatigue life assessment method for the wheel loader working design.In design phase,based on the strain-stress test data of the original model,after scaling the test data,takes it as the input of the ANSYS finite element simulation analysis of the L120 working device,and evaluates the working device fatigue life.After that,based on the measured data of the prototype,the evaluation confirmed that the L120 working device can meet the target life requirement and shorten the product development cycle.At the same time,the method of working device design and testing is verified,which provides a new reference method of subsequent wheel loader loading unit design.In this article,preliminary progress has been made in improving the design of the working device linkage mechanism,improving the fatigue life of the working device,and exploring the verification method.The results of the research and analysis have guiding significance for the subsequent wheel loader loading unit design.
